23A – Your Venture’s Unfair Advantage
1. Local Expertise
a. Valuable - You want your coach to know about the local area of your business.
b. Rare - Experienced local business coaches are harder to find.
c. Inimitable - Hard to copy because local experts are hard to find.
d. Non-substitutable - There is no substitute for local expertise.
2. Number of Coaches
a. Valuable - You want to have more options to be able to find a right fit.
b. Rare - Not many business coaching offer multiple options for coaches.
c. Inimitable - Can be copied by other people.
d. Non-substitutable - can be substituted.
3. Coaches with years of experience
a. Valuable - You want your coaches to have years of experience.
b. Rare - Experienced coaches are rare.
c. Inimitable - hard to copy immediately.
d. Non-substitutable - There is no substitute for experience.
4. Low Cost
a. Valuable - having a low cost business makes it easier to make money and expand
b. Rare - there are not many low cost buisnesses.
c. Inimitable - it can be copied.
d. Non-substitutable - there is no substitute.
5. Financial Capital
a. Valuable - having financial capital to get the business going is very valuable.
b. Rare - it is hard to get money to start a business.
c. Inimitable - it can be copied.
d. Non-substitutable - it can be substituted.
6. Large Target Market
a. Valuable - you want a lot of potential customers.
b. Rare - not every business has a large target market.
c. Inimitable - it can be copied.
d. Non-substitutable - having a large target market can be substituted for smaller markets.
7. Bilingual
a. Valuable - being able to speak multiple languages is very valuable because it allows you to reach more potential customers.
b. Rare - it's not rare but it is not common
c. Inimitable -anybody can learn a new language.
d. Non-substitutable - it is not substitutable.
8. Network of people
a. Valuable - having a network of people is very valuable because it allows you.
b. Rare - it's not rare to build a network of people but it is hard.
c. Inimitable - it can be copied but it will take time.
d. Non-substitutable - there is no substitute for a network of people.
9. Programming
a. Valuable - knowing how to program is useful for making apps.
b. Rare - not everyone knows how to do it.
c. Inimitable - u can learn how to do it.
d. Non-substitutable - it is not necessary for my business and if you need to you can always hire someone.
10. Business Model
a. Valuable - because of its low cost i believe it is valuable.
b. Rare - it is rare because there are not many like mine.
c. Inimitable - it can be copied by anyone.
d. Non-substitutable - there are always other business plans that can work.
